INDIRECT FEMALE SEX WORKERS BEHAVIOR TOWARDS VOLUNTARILY COUNSELLING AND TESTING (VCT) IN SLEMAN DISTRICT OF YOGYAKARTA: A PHENOMENOLOGICAL STUDY

Journal Title: World Journal of Advance Healthcare Research - Year 2018, Vol 2, Issue 5

Abstract

Background: HIV/AIDS among sex workers are one of the problems that need world‟s special attention. Indirect female sex workers carry the high risk of being contaminated with HIV/AIDS compare to nonfemale sex workers. Voluntarily Counselling and Testing (VCT) is one of the strategies of public health which is effective to prevention and at the same time is an entry point to get management service of case and treatment, support and medication for HIV/AIDS patients. Purpose: This research aims to discuss indirect female sex workers behavior towards VCT in the area of Sleman District of Yogyakarta. Method: This was a qualitative research with phenomenological study approach, applied to get a real illustration and an in-depth input of indirect female sex workers behavior towards VCT. Data collection was conducted in September 2017 towards indirect female sex workers working at beauty salon and “plusplus” spa in the area of Sleman District amounted to 4 people. Result: Knowledge about HIV/AIDS is good enough but an understanding of VCT is lacking. Indirect female sex workers have tried to use condom during sexual intercourse with their customer. Thus, indirect female sex workers‟ knowledge about HIV/AIDS is pretty good but their understanding of VCT is lacking since they do not have good mood to conduct VCT although considering that it is important. Conclusion: Indirect female sex workers never maximally conducted VCT.
